[QUOTE="ph_il, post: 648773, member: 508"] Good points, NL. I never thought if it that way, but that could in fact be what is what holding me back. I did a little experiment and I played in an SNG, but without the intention of keeping track of my win or lose. I just wanted to see how I would play and I played just as well as I used to. I was just as aggressive-if not more than usual, I stuck with my reads and didnt second guess my actions. My aggressive plays allowed me to win the game. I even had the person I was going heads up with call me a bad name because of the way I was playing...LOL. But the main point is, I got none of those 'I hope I dont lose' jitters. Basically, I had the confidence I was lacking. So, I think Im done with the challenge and Ill just focus on building my BR. [/QUOTE]
